Stephanie Jones of Conemaugh Health System to chair 2023 Cambria Somerset Heart Ball

As plans are underway for the 2023 Cambria Somerset Heart Ball, Stephanie Jones, director of cardiovascular and respiratory services at Conemaugh Memorial Medical Center in Johnstown, Pennsylvania, has been named chair of this year’s community-wide campaign. The Heart Ball celebrates progress made through the dedication and passion of all who support the American Heart Association throughout the year and are committed to investing in saving and improving lives in the community.

“As a nurse, I know first-hand the devastating effects of heart disease and stroke,” said Jones. “The American Heart Association has long supported scientific research that is helping more and more people survive, including heart and stroke patients right here in our community.”

A 22-year veteran at Conemaugh, Jones has spent 20 years of her career in cardiovascular services and assisted in achieving and promoting accreditations from the American College of Cardiology as a center for chest pain with Primary PCI and heart failure at Conemaugh. She recently has developed a Heart Failure Program at Conemaugh Hospital.

A Johnstown native and Bishop McCort Catholic High School alumnus, she graduated from Conemaugh School of Nursing in 2000. She received a bachelor’s degree in nursing from the University of Pittsburgh and a master’s degree, with an emphasis of leadership, from Grand Canyon University. She is pursuing a Master of Business Administration at St. Francis University.

The 2023 Cambria Somerset Heart Ball is slated for Saturday, February 18, 2023, at Sunnehanna Country Club in Johnstown. The annual celebratory event is a night to honor survivors, patrons and volunteers of the American Heart Association, the world’s leading nonprofit organization focused on heart and brain health. The evening will feature stories from survivors, presentation of the annual Heart Hall of Fame Award, as well as dinner, dancing and a silent and live auction. The event is sponsored by Conemaugh Health System, Conemaugh Physicians Group, UPMC and UPMC Health Plan, First Summit Bank, Highmark, Concurrent Technologies Corporation, Ameriserv and other generous supporters.

The dollars raised by the Cambria Somerset Heart Ball fund the mission of the American Heart Association to be a relentless force for a world of longer, healthier lives while working toward the Association’s 2024 Health Equity Impact Goal, reducing barriers to health care access and quality.
